Course Details

The Health and Safety (Display Screen) Equipment Regulations came into force on January 1st 1993. This course covers these regulations and offers help and advice to enable delegates to stay within the law when using Display Screen Equipment.

Aims and Objectives

By the end of the course delegates will have an in-depth knowledge of the regulations and how to work with Display Screen Equipment Safely.

 

The Course Covers

  • Understanding the Health and Safety (Display Screen Equipment) Regulations 1992
  • Define who is a Display Screen User
  • Analyze the Workstation to assess and reduce Health and Safety Risks, e.g. Musculoskeletal Problems, Visual Fatigue and Mental Stress
  • Rest Breaks
  • Eye and Eyesight tests
  • The Keyboard
  • Desks, Chairs and Workstations
